Im looking to get book published soon on the history of the Club, need some help with former players - who they played for after leaving Stirling Albion. Some were trialists.

Hope you can help.

Name, - Previous Club - (time with Stirling Albion)

Joseph Carruth, - Celtic - (11/08/45 to 30/08/45)
James Pidgeon, - Albion Rovers - (11/08/45 to 30/08/45)
Walter Sneddon, - Clackmannan Hearts - (01/09/45 to 19/01/46)
J Morgan, - ??? - (08/09/45 to 08/09/45)
Alexander Wilson, - Westquarter - (22/10/45 to 16/01/46)
Dave Hunter, - Falkirk - (03/11/45 to 10/11/45)
N Wilson, - ??? - (17/11/45 to 01/12/45)
Jack Brock, - Falkirk - (10/08/46 to 02/11/46)
Robert B Murray, - Hearts - (10/08/46 to 24/08/46)
David Coull, - St. Johnstone - (23/08/47 to 25/09/47)
Robert Black, - Arbroath - (30/08/47 to 25/09/47)
Richard Scott, - Dunfermline Athletic - (30/08/47 to 18/10/47)
George Campbell, - Dumbarton - (18/10/47 to 29/04/48)
Alexander Russell, - Clyde - (18/12/47 to 17/01/48)
J Wilson, - ??? - (12/05/50 to 12/05/50)
Sam Watters, - Alloa Athletic - (17/05/51 to 21/05/51)
Hugh McDonald, - ??? - (18/05/51 to 18/05/51)
William Miller, - St Mirren - (19/04/52 to 18/05/52)
Peter Anderson, - St. Mirren - (03/05/52 to 06/08/52)
John Creelman, - Albion Rovers - (24/05/52 to 30/04/53)
Ian Harper, - Ayr United - (25/08/52 to 03/09/52)
Frank Elliot, - Kelvindale United - (01/09/52 to 22/09/52)
Willie Smith, - ??? - (01/09/52 to 01/09/52)
Dugald Mathieson, - Inverness Thistle - (27/09/52 to 21/10/52)
Thomas Mack, - Falkirk - (10/12/52 to 30/04/53)
George S Harbour, - Queen's Park - (13/12/52 to 30/04/53)
Thomas McCabe, - Falkirk - (25/02/53 to 30/04/53)
William Burgess, - Loanhead Mayflower - (16/01/54 to 30/04/57)
Colin Johnstone, - Alloa Athletic - (06/05/55 to 10/05/55)
Donald MacKenzie, - Arbroath - (03/09/55 to 25/04/56)
John (Jack) Wood, - Newburgh - (26/01/56 to 25/04/56)
George Melrose, - St Mirren - (05/05/56 to 05/05/56)
Douglas Morrison, - Jordanhill College - (04/08/56 to 30/04/59)
Colin McLean, - Alloa Athletic - (23/08/56 to 27/09/56)
John Hailstones, - Dalkeith - (27/12/58 to 30/04/61)
John McNaughton, - Auchinleck Talbot - (19/09/59 to 30/04/60)
William Andrew, - Falkirk - (02/07/60 to 30/04/61)
Andrew P McEwan, - Queen of the South - (09/08/60 to 30/04/62)
William Smith, - Queen's Park, trial? Cumnock? - (13/08/60 to 29/10/60)
Campbell Elliot, - Arthurlie - (10/10/61 to 28/04/63)
James Cattenach, - ??? - (27/11/61 to 27/11/61)
James Robertson, - Tullialan Thistle Juveniles - (13/01/62 to 28/04/63)
James Fish, - Woodburn Athletic - (17/07/62 to 20/04/64)
Boston Glegg, - Stenhousemuir - (14/05/63 to 04/07/63)
Gordon McBain, - Brechin City - (15/06/63 to 20/04/64)
James McInally, - Third Lanark - (04/07/63 to 23/04/65)
Ronald Brown, - ??? - (13/09/63 to 20/04/64)
John Fraser Carswell, - Dunipace Juniors - (14/11/63 to 20/04/64)
Andrew Bannon, - Dunipace Juniors - (04/11/63 to 20/04/64)
William Campbell, - Portsmouth - (23/07/64 to 23/04/65)
David Joseph McDonald, - Preston North End - (01/08/66 to 20/04/67)
Alan Laing, - Newtongrange Star - (20/09/66 to 30/04/68)
Walter Myles, - Bonnybridge Juniors - (28/01/67 to 30/04/68)
Archibald Shedden, - Renfrew Juniors - (31/08/67 to 30/04/68)
William Allan Gray, - Kippen - (07/09/67 to 11/01/68)
Bruce Munro, - St. Johnstone - (27/10/67 to 30/04/68)
George Brough, - Hawick Royal Albert - (05/05/68 to 20/04/69)
Donald May, - Dumbarton - (07/12/68 to 06/01/69)
Andrew Smith, - Northampton - (25/06/70 to 31/12/70)
Thomas Chapman, - Whitehill Welfare - (30/06/70 to end Apr 71)
Robert Rough, - Ayr United - (16/07/73 to end Apr 74)
Eddie Cattenach, - Grangemouth International - (11/08/75 to 30/07/77)
John Colquhoun, - Bothkennar - (28/07/88 to 06/12/90)
Larry Haggart, - Alloa Athletic - (07/08/90 to 08/01/91)
Stephen Dornan, - Netherleas - (01/10/90 to 15/05/91)
Scott McCallum, - Dunfermline - (30/07/93 to 30/07/93)
Eddie Coyle, - Dundee United - (22/04/97 to 22/04/97)
Jason Malcolmson, - Stenhousemuir U18 - (22/04/97 to 22/04/97)
Sean Craig, - ??? - (23/07/98 to 23/07/98)
Alan Kays, - ??? - (19/07/99 to 19/07/99)
David Butler, - SAFC Youths - (15/07/00 to 15/05/03)
Marc Couper, - Dundee United - (15/07/00 to 29/07/00)
Paul Brown, - Queen's Park - (24/07/00 to 26/07/00)
Ross Johnston, - SAFC Youths - (22/09/00 to 15/05/03)
Darren Kearney, - Morton - (22/11/01 to 15/05/02)
Scott Miller, - Morton - (13/07/02 to 13/07/02)
David McCole, - Berwick Rangers - (25/07/02 to 15/05/03)
Christopher Henny, - SAFC Youths - (31/08/02 to 15/05/04)
Chris Turner, - ??? - (18/07/03 to 19/07/03)
James Sandyhills, - ??? - (26/07/03 to 26/07/03)
Donny Ritchie, - Alloa Athletic - (23/07/05 to 24/07/05)
Sergio Rodriguez, - Vancouver Whitecaps - (18/07/07 to 18/07/07)
Chris Watson, - Hamilton Academical - (18/07/07 to 18/07/07)
John McGoldrick, - Partick Thistle - (22/08/07 to 22/08/07)
Juan Carlos, - ??? - (20/07/08 to 20/07/08)
Paul Gable, - Chicago Fire - (20/07/08 to 23/07/08)
Andy Munster, - ??? - (12/07/11 to 12/07/11)
